THIS WRIT PETITION IS FILED UNDER ARTICLES 226 AND 227 OF THE CONSTITUTION OF INDIA PRAYING TO ISSUE WRIT OF MANDAMUS OR ANY OTHER WRIT DIRECTING THE RESPONDENT TO CONSIDER THE APPLICATION DATED 15/09/2025 (VIDE ANNEXURE-J) AND COMMUNICATE THE FINE AMOUNT PAYABLE FOR CONVERSION IN ACCORDANCE WITH RULE 107 OF THE KARNATAKA LAND REVENUE RULES, 1966 TO THE PETITIONER & ETC.

THIS PETITION, COMING ON FOR PRELIMINARY HEARING, THIS DAY, ORDER WAS MADE THEREIN AS UNDER:

CORAM: HON'BLE MR. VIBHU BAKHRU, CHIEF JUSTICE and HON'BLE MR. JUSTICE C.M. POONACHA

ORAL ORDER

(PER: HON'BLE MR. VIBHU BAKHRU, CHIEF JUSTICE)

1. Issue notice. The learned Additional Government Advocate accepts notice for the respondents.

2. The petitioners have filed the present petition, inter alia, praying as under:

"a. Issue writ of Mandamus or any other writ directing the respondent to consider the application dated 15.09.2025 (vide ANNEXURE-J) and communicate the fine amount payable for conversion in accordance with Rule 107 of the Karnataka Land Revenue Rules, 1966 to the petitioner.

b. Issue a Writ of Mandamus or any other order or any other writ or direction directing the Respondent No.2 to consider the application dated 01.09.2025 (vide ANNEXURE-H) and to pass an order of deemed conversion in terms of the provision encarved under sub-section (9) of Section 95 of the Karnataka Land Revenue Act, 1964."

3. The petitioners state that they are the absolute owners of the lands falling in Survey No.160/1 and 160/2 situated at Badasinam Village, Belgavi Taluk, Belgavi District. The petitioners proposed to carry out quarrying operations for mining laterite from the land to the extent of 12 acres out of 16 acres and 5 guntas. They claim that they entered into an irrevocable agreement on 29.06.2021 with Swarna Aditya Gold Refinery and Resources Private Limited for completing the documentation and legal work for setting up the operations for mining laterite.

4. On 08.09.2021, the said company made an application to declare the land as falling in safe zone and sought a quarrying licence in Form AQL. Pursuant to the said application, respondent No.3 sent communications to the concerned revenue and forest officials for their NOC and a joint survey. On 01.09.2025, the said company also filed an application under Section 95(9) of the Karnataka Land Revenue Act, 1964 for deemed conversion of the subject land. Subsequently, it also sought information regarding the amount payable under Rule 107 of the Karnataka Land Revenue Rules, 1966.

5. The petitioners claim that their applications have not been considered as yet.
